淘宝订单API如何实现订单退款?
随着电子商务的蓬勃发展,越来越多的消费者选择在淘宝购物。然而,在购物过程中,难免会遇到一些问题,比如商品质量问题、退换货等。那么,淘宝订单API如何实现订单退款呢?本文将为您详细解析。
淘宝订单API退款流程
调用退款接口:首先,商家需要通过淘宝订单API调用退款接口,提交退款申请。退款接口的URL格式为:https://api.taobao.com/router/rest?api_name=alipay.trade.refund
传入参数:在调用退款接口时,需要传入以下参数:
- biz_content:退款业务内容,包括订单号、退款金额、退款原因等;
- app_id:应用的ID;
- method:API名称,此处为alipay.trade.refund;
- format:返回数据的格式,如JSON、XML等;
- sign_type:签名类型,如RSA2;
- timestamp:请求时间戳;
- version:API版本,如1.0;
- sign:签名,用于验证请求的合法性。
获取退款结果:提交退款申请后,淘宝会返回退款结果。如果退款成功,则返回“success”;如果退款失败,则返回错误信息。
案例分析
某商家在淘宝平台上销售手机,客户在购买过程中发现手机存在质量问题,希望申请退款。商家通过淘宝订单API调用退款接口,传入订单号、退款金额等参数,提交退款申请。淘宝系统审核通过后,成功退款至客户账户。
注意事项
确保订单信息准确:在调用退款接口时,务必确保订单信息准确无误,以免影响退款进度。
关注退款状态:退款申请提交后,商家应密切关注退款状态,及时处理退款异常。
了解退款规则:不同商品和场景的退款规则可能有所不同,商家应提前了解相关规则,确保退款顺利进行。
通过以上解析,相信您已经对淘宝订单API退款流程有了清晰的认识。在今后的电商运营中,合理运用API功能,为消费者提供更好的购物体验。
猜你喜欢:海外直播音画不同步